The feeding behaviour of two leafhoppers on Vicia faba

M. S. GÜNTHARDT, Heike Wanner

Open publisher page 20 citations

Abstract

Abstract. The feeding behaviour of the two Typhlocybinae Empoasca decipiens Paoli and Eupteryx atropunctata Goetze and the nature of the damage caused to Vicia faba L. were investigated. Sections with stylets in situ , i.e. within the plant, were obtained. Eupteryx atropunctata sucked mainly from the palisade parenchyma of the leaf, while several generations of Empoasca decipiens could also live from the stem parenchyma and pierced into phloem if this was reachable.
